Lejano Oriente is aSpanishphrase. It means: Área geográfica de límites imprecisos, pero considerada generalmente como la parte de Asia al este del río Indo, comprendiendo las zonas de influencia de la cultura india y china. Pronounced [leˈxano oˈɾjẽn̪t̪e].
